The Foundation: What is a Quantitative Beta hCG Test?
Before we can unravel the concept of a false negative, we must first understand what the test is designed to measure. Human Chorionic Gonadotropin (hCG) is a hormone often dubbed the 'pregnancy hormone.' It is produced by the cells that eventually form the placenta shortly after a fertilized egg attaches to the uterine lining.
The qualitative hCG test is the familiar over-the-counter urine test, which simply answers 'yes' or 'no' to the presence of hCG above a certain threshold. The quantitative beta hCG test, however, is a different beast entirely. Performed on a blood sample in a laboratory, it measures the exact concentration of the beta subunit of the hCG hormone in your bloodstream, reported in milli-international units per milliliter (mIU/mL). This precise number is a powerful tool, but it is not infallible.
Deconstructing the "False Negative"
Strictly speaking, a true 'false negative' in a quantitative test—where the test reports no hCG detected despite a viable pregnancy—is exceptionally rare. The test is highly sensitive and can detect even minuscule amounts of the hormone. The more common, and far more clinically relevant, scenario is what many patients perceive as a false negative: a quantitatively low beta hCG result that does not align with clinical expectations or a patient's symptoms. This result can be misleading, suggesting a non-pregnancy or a non-viable pregnancy when the reality may be more complex.
The Biological Clock: Testing Too Early
This is, by far, the most common reason for a surprisingly low beta hCG result. The timeline of conception and implantation is not an exact science. Ovulation can shift, and implantation of the blastocyst into the uterine wall can occur anywhere from 6 to 12 days after ovulation.
Only after implantation does the body begin producing hCG. The hormone then needs time to enter the bloodstream and multiply to a level high enough to be detected by a blood test. While some sensitive tests can detect hCG as low as 1-5 mIU/mL, it takes time for the concentration to rise.
- The Rule of Doubling: In a healthy early pregnancy, beta hCG levels typically double approximately every 48 to 72 hours. This is a critical concept. A single low number is almost meaningless without a second data point for comparison.
- The Pitfall of a Single Test: A person who tests just 8 days after ovulation might have an hCG level of 10 mIU/mL. If their clinician was expecting a number above 25 or 50 based on their last menstrual period (which is a less precise dating method), this result could be incorrectly interpreted as negative or abnormal. In reality, they may simply be very early in their pregnancy.
Beyond Timing: Other Causes for Low or Misleading hCG Results
While timing is the predominant factor, several other physiological and technical issues can lead to a perplexing quantitative beta hCG result.
1. Ectopic Pregnancy
An ectopic pregnancy, where the embryo implants outside the uterine cavity (most commonly in a fallopian tube), is a serious medical condition. In these cases, the pregnancy is not viable, and the trophoblast cells often secrete hCG less efficiently. This can result in beta hCG levels that are low for gestational age and, crucially, that rise in an abnormal pattern—they may increase slowly, plateau, or even fall and rise again. A single low test can be the first, and sometimes only, red flag for an ectopic pregnancy, making follow-up testing absolutely imperative.
2. Impending Miscarriage (Chemical Pregnancy)
A very early pregnancy loss, sometimes called a chemical pregnancy, occurs when a pregnancy ends shortly after implantation. In this sad but common scenario, the beta hCG level may have been initially low or may have started to rise normally before plateauing and decreasing. A single test showing a low level could be captured during this decline, representing a pregnancy that is unfortunately not progressing rather than a 'false' signal.
3. Laboratory and Technical Variability
While modern laboratories maintain rigorous standards, no test is perfect. Potential, though uncommon, technical issues include:
- Sample Handling Errors: Improper storage or handling of the blood sample could theoretically degrade the hCG hormone before analysis.
- Assay Interference: Certain rare antibodies or other proteins in a patient's blood can sometimes interfere with the immunoassay technology used to measure hCG, leading to an artificially low reading. This is known as heterophile antibody interference.
- Lab Error: Simple human error, such as mislabeling a sample or transposing numbers in a report, while rare, remains a possibility.
4. The "Hook Effect" in Quantitative Tests
Most associated with qualitative urine tests, the 'hook effect' is a phenomenon where extremely high levels of hCG can oversaturate the antibodies used in the test, ironically leading to a false low or negative result. This is highly uncommon in modern quantitative laboratory assays because labs will automatically dilute samples with very high analyte levels and re-run them. However, if this dilution step is not performed, it remains a remote theoretical cause for an inaccurate low value, typically only seen in cases of molar pregnancies or multiple gestations with extraordinarily high hCG levels.
The Golden Rule: Serial Beta hCG Testing
This is the most important takeaway for any patient or provider confronting a low quantitative beta hCG result. A single value is a snapshot; two values taken 48-72 hours apart are a movie. The trend is infinitely more valuable than the initial number.
A clinician is not looking for a single 'perfect' number. They are analyzing the rate of increase (or decrease).
- Reassuring Trend: A doubling (or near-doubling) rise over 48-72 hours is strongly indicative of a developing intrauterine pregnancy.
- Concerning Trend: A slow rise, a plateau, or a fall in hCG levels suggests a failing pregnancy (miscarriage) or an ectopic pregnancy and warrants further investigation, typically with ultrasound.
Waiting for that second test is often an agonizing period, but it is a necessary one for accurate diagnosis.
What To Do If You Question Your Result
If your quantitative beta hCG result feels wrong—perhaps you have strong pregnancy symptoms, or you are far enough along that the number seems implausibly low—do not panic. Take a systematic approach.
- Communicate with Your Healthcare Provider: This is your first and most important step. Express your concerns clearly. Ask them to explain the result in the context of your specific situation, including the date of your last period and ovulation, if known.
- Advocate for Serial Testing: Politely but firmly ask for a follow-up quantitative test in 48 hours. This is a standard and reasonable request when a result is ambiguous.
- Ensure Accurate Dating: Reconfirm the first day of your last menstrual period. Inaccurate dating is a common source of confusion.
- Consider a Second Opinion: In rare cases where communication has broken down or your concerns are being dismissed, seeking a second opinion from another clinician is a valid option.
- Prioritize Your Emotional Health: The wait for answers is incredibly stressful. Lean on your support system, practice self-care, and try to manage anxiety through distraction and mindfulness. Remember that the result is information, not a final verdict.
